Common Nuisance Wildlife in La Habra

La Habra's proximity to natural foothills and urban landscapes creates a unique environment where wildlife and human habitats often intersect. Knowing which animals are most likely to cause issues is the first step in effective management.

  • Rodents & Bats: This category includes roof rats, house mice, and tree squirrels, which are notorious for seeking shelter in attics, wall voids, and crawl spaces. Bats, while beneficial for insect control, can form colonies in structures, creating noise, odor, and significant guano accumulation.
  • Mammalian Predators: Raccoons, skunks, opossums, and coyotes are frequently encountered. Raccoons are clever and can damage roofs and vents to gain attic access. Skunks may den under decks or sheds, while coyotes are a growing concern in many Southern California neighborhoods, posing a risk to small pets.
  • Birds: Pigeons and starlings are common avian pests. Their nesting materials can clog gutters and vents, and their droppings are not only unsightly but can be corrosive and pose health risks.

What to Do (and Not Do) When You Have Wildlife

Taking the wrong action can worsen the problem, violate laws, or put you in danger. Follow these guidelines for safe and legal wildlife conflict resolution.

Do:

  • Seal Entry Points: After ensuring no animals are inside, seal all potential entry holes with durable materials like steel mesh or hardware cloth. This is the cornerstone of long-term exclusion.
  • Remove Attractants: Secure trash cans with locking lids, pick up fallen fruit from trees, and never leave pet food outdoors overnight. A clean yard is a less inviting yard for wildlife.
  • Use Live Traps Appropriately: For animals like squirrels or raccoons, live cage traps can be effective. However, they must be checked frequently, as per California law, and you must have a plan for the trapped animal.

Don't:

  • Relocate Trapped Animals: It is generally illegal in California to trap and relocate most wild animals off your property. Relocation spreads disease and often sentences the animal to a slow death in unfamiliar territory. The legal options are to release the animal on-site or humanely euthanize it.
  • Use Poison Rodenticides: Poison is strongly discouraged. It causes animals to die in inaccessible areas, leading to severe odor problems. It also poses a high risk of secondary poisoning to pets, birds of prey, and other non-target wildlife that may eat the poisoned rodent.
  • Attempt DIY Removal of Dangerous Animals: Never attempt to handle or trap bats (due to rabies risks), coyotes, or any animal that appears sick or aggressive. This is a job for professionals.

Understanding Local Regulations and Who to Call

Navigating the rules is crucial. In La Habra and Los Angeles County, several key regulations govern wildlife control 1 2 3:

  • Trapping within 150 yards of an occupied residence requires the written consent of the resident or property owner.
  • Feeding non-domesticated mammals is illegal.
  • Most species cannot be relocated; they must be released on the capture site or humanely euthanized.

Knowing which agency to contact saves time:

  • La Habra City Animal Control: Contact them for issues involving domestic animals-stray dogs, dog bites, or licensing. They also handle emergencies with aggressive animals running at large or visibly sick or injured wildlife, as they can arrange for care or euthanasia.
  • Private Wildlife Removal Companies: For active infestations inside your home (like bats in the attic, rodents in walls, or raccoons in the chimney), you will typically need to contact a licensed private wildlife control operator. City and county agencies often refer residents to these professionals for complex wildlife exclusion and removal jobs.

Professional Wildlife Control Services Available

When a wildlife problem exceeds DIY solutions, professional animal removal services offer comprehensive solutions. These experts are trained in both humane techniques and building science to solve your current problem and prevent future ones.

Core Services Include:

  • Inspection & Identification: Professionals accurately identify the species, locate all entry points, and assess the extent of the infestation.
  • Humane Trapping & Removal: Using methods compliant with California law, they safely remove the offending animals.
  • Exclusion: This is the most critical and permanent solution. Technicians seal every potential entry point with professional-grade materials to permanently deny wildlife access to your structure.
  • Cleanup & Sanitation: After removal, they address the mess left behind. This can include removing nesting materials, vacuuming bat guano, and applying enzymatic cleaners for odor control.
  • Damage Repair: Many companies can also repair damage caused by wildlife, such as chewed wires, torn insulation, or damaged vent screens.

A Step-by-Step Guide for La Habra Homeowners

Follow this logical process to address a wildlife issue effectively and responsibly.

  1. Identify the Culprit: Look for signs. Do you hear scurrying in the ceiling (likely rodents or squirrels)? See droppings (identify by shape and size)? Notice a strong musky odor (possibly a skunk or raccoon)? Accurate identification dictates the solution 4.
  2. Implement Immediate Prevention: While you plan your next steps, remove all outdoor food and water sources. Secure trash and compost bins. This can sometimes encourage animals to move on naturally.
  3. Choose Your Removal Method: For a single ground squirrel or opossum, a properly set and monitored live trap may suffice. For animals in the attic, birds in vents, or any sign of bats or coyotes, it's time to call a professional wildlife removal company 5 6.
  4. Seal the Entry Points: Whether you do it yourself after removal or hire a pro, exclusion is non-negotiable. If you don't seal the entryways, new animals will simply move into the now-vacant, desirable den site 7.
  5. Know Who to Call for Help: Keep numbers handy. For aggressive wildlife or injured animals, call La Habra Animal Control. For an infestation requiring trapping and exclusion, you'll need a private wildlife control operator 8 9 10.

Costs for professional services in La Habra vary widely based on the animal, the extent of the infestation, and the services required. Simple trapping may start at a few hundred dollars, while a full attic restoration for a rodent infestation can cost $1,000 or more. Exclusion work, such as sealing a roof line or installing chimney caps, is an investment that prevents recurring problems and protects your property's value 11 12 13.
